Note that the game only updates the save file intermittently, which can lead to problems with save data syncing. I always make sure to exit to main menu, which seems to force a save. Also, if you are having issues, try to wait at least 15-20 seconds after closing the game before launching it on a different device to ensure that the iCloud sync completes.
